School Description
School Summary and Highlights
- Enrolls 35 high school students from grades 9-12
- 2010 Overall School AYP Met Status: Yes
Additional Contact Information
- Mailing Address: PO Box 307, Vallecito, CA 95251
School Operational Details
- Alternative School
School District Details
- Bret Harte Union High School District
- Per-Pupil Spending: $12,823
- Dropout Rate: 0.4%
- Students Per Teacher: 17.4
- Enrolled Students: 846
Faculty Details and Student Enrollment
Students and Faculty
- Total Students Enrolled: 35
- Total Full Time "Equivalent" Teachers: 2.3
- Average Student-To-Teacher Ratio: 15.0
Students Gender Breakdown
- Males: 20 (57.1%)
- Females: 15 (42.9%)
Free Lunch Student Eligibility Breakdown
- Eligible for Reduced Lunch: 6 (17.1%)
- Eligible for Free Lunch: 12 (34.3%)
- Eligible for Either Reduced or Free Lunch: 18 (51.4%)
